According to the IRS Refund Cycle Chart, my direct deposit should be sent on March 16. Will it actually show up in my bank account on that day? Or the day after/before?

It should show up in your bank account that morning. Mine have always shown up on the exact day that the IRS says it is doing a direct deposit. However, there have been a few on this site that were suppose to get a direct deposit on a specific day, and for some reason on that Friday, it was not posted to their account. If you went through a tax preparation service and they have to take fees out first, you may not see your direct deposit on that day--it may take a few days later.

Unless they question something about your return, your refund should hit your bank account on the day on the chart. If you filed through a company that runs the refund through their bank (like to take your preparation fees out of your refund), that can take an extra few days to actually get to your account..
